Do Si Dos Feminized is an Indica-dominant hybrid bred from Girl Scout Cookies and Face Off OG, combining elite Cookie lineage with classic Kush structure. Known for its high potency, dense bud formation, and balanced experiential effects, this feminized version delivers consistent results for growers seeking reliability and quality. Type: Feminized photoperiod cannabis seeds Genetics: Girl Scout Cookies x Face Off OG THC: Up to 30% Indica / Sativa: 70% Indica / 30% Sativa Flowering Time: 8–10 weeks Outdoor Harvest: End of September Yield Potential: 400–500 g/m² Height: Medium, typically 100–180 cm Climate: Tropical, Subtropical, Warm Primary Terpenes: Linalool, Beta-Caryophyllene, Limonene Taste Profile: Earthy, Skunky, Sweet, Pine Browse all Feminized Seeds

I found this strain fairly easy in organic living soil, fast germination, problem free, good yields and very strong. I was away longer than expected near the end of flowering and they looked a little droopy but soon sprang back with excellent results.
